Triveni Digital SCTE Cable-Tec Expo Preview

As the number of ATSC 3.0 deployments grow rapidly across the U.S., cable operators without a direct link to broadcast stations must pick up transmissions over the air and validate that the streams are compliant. Evaluating the quality of both ATSC 1.0 and ATSC 3.0 transmissions is critical to ensure a superior quality of service (QoS) for subscribers. StreamScope® Combo Analyzer for ATSC 1.0 and ATSC 3.0

Triveni Digital’s StreamScope® ATSC 3.0 and ATSC 1.0 Combo Analyzer is the only solution on the market today that supports both standards, allowing operators to compare streams and quickly detect, isolate, and resolve issues to ensure high-quality viewing experiences at all times.

The StreamScope Combo Analyzer features StreamScope XM Dashboard software to streamline network monitoring, analysis, and maintenance for ATSC 3.0. Additionally, it offers a 12-port input card from DekTec, allowing operators to simultaneously analyze multiple ATSC 1.0 and ATSC 3.0 streams, which increases efficiency, speed, and cost savings. Using the StreamScope Combo Analyzer, operators can create rules-based alarms to quickly pinpoint service quality issues.
